The line represented by the equation 3x + 5y = 2 has a slope of -3/5 . Which shows the graph of this equation?

what exactly is being asked? the slope is easy as all you have to do is move the 3x over so that 5y = -3x + 2 
divide by 5 and you get y = -3/5x +0.4
that's the equation of the graph if that's what is being asked
